A 13-year old boy has been arrested on charge of separately raping two minor girls, aged 5 and 9 years, at Gyalshing in West Sikkim, police said today.
In another incident of sexual assault, a 19-year-old boy has been arrested by the police for having molested an elderly woman at Namchi in South Sikkim.
In the Gyalshing incident the 13-year old, a resident of 5th mile locality allegedly raped the 5-year-old girl at around 11 am on November 20, police said quoting the complaint later lodged by the child's mother.
The girl, who is in a serious condition, has been referred to the S T N M Hospital, Gangtok.
In another complaint filed by the mother of a nine-year girl, the same person allegedly commited the crime on the victim some days back in the same area and the matter came to light when a neighbour informed the girl's mother and the little girl broke down while corroborating, police said.
The girl was sent for medical examination.
In the Namchi incident, the 19-year old sexually assaulted the 69-year old woman twice in her house in the wee hours when she was alone by barging into, police said quoting a complaint at the Namchi police station, police said.
